2016-03-07 | rework menu based config system | Waldemar Brodkorb | |
After the addition of bare metal toolchains the menu system allowed to create non-valid configurations. I reworked it so we can also add other operating system support if we wish. So first you choose your operating system, then your architecture and endianess, after that your embedded system, emulator or generic device and then you choose your task you want to run. Tasks may be toolchain, a new appliance/application or some preconfigured sets of packages and configurations as kodi, mpd, firefox and more. The tasks are limited to a plausible choice of hardware and software. Deduplicate CPU configuration. You don't wanna compile Kodi for a H8/300 microcontroller ;) | |||
